Transaction 652617b1d27f436e09add771bb65de4f24408d06ef2eaa0ba50a08c4132a956e
1 Input
1 Output
-
652617b1d27f436e09add771bb65de4f24408d06ef2eaa0ba50a08c4132a956e:0
- value
- 161014
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5d488bcf08e9e77815f6d92f88ddd97f8ed1b2a
- address
- bc1quh2g308s36080q2ldkf03rwajluw6xe2mlq2ns